The Boy From Space was first shown in 1971, when schools TV was still black and white, but it had been filmed in colour anyway. So when the BBC were on the look out for a new Look and Read to be made on the cheap at the end of the 70s, it seemed like a good idea to reuse the old story material, and just make new teaching segments. In the end though, this 'remake' ended up actually costing more to make than a completely new story would have! A short introduction set in 1980 was added to the beginning, with Helen and Dan driving back to the observatory and reliving the story in flashback. Helen then narrates the whole story, but there's no contemporary coda or other later references to the reunion.
The in-between bits featured a life-size Wordy in his orbiting spacestation, Wordlab 1, with a human assistant called Cosmo, and many of the educational songs were sung by two stars and other space creatures.
